According to the 2021 Census of Population, Division No. 5, Subd. F in Newfoundland and Labrador had a total population of 746 residents. This reflects a 9.4% population decline from 823 residents in 2016, a decrease of 77 people over five years. With a land area of 823.72 km², the region has a very low population density of just 0.9 people per square kilometre, highlighting its rural and sparsely populated character.

Population Growth Trends

The decline in population between 2016 and 2021 continues a trend seen in many remote parts of Newfoundland and Labrador, where younger populations often migrate to larger towns or other provinces for education and employment opportunities.

  • 2016 Population: 823
  • 2021 Population: 746
  • Change: -77 (-9.4%)

Age Distribution

The population of Division No. 5, Subd. F is relatively older compared to the provincial average. The median age is 49.2 years, and nearly one in five residents (19.5%) is aged 65 or older.

Age GroupPopulationPercent
0–14 years11014.8%
15–64 years49065.8%
65+ years14519.5%

Households & Dwellings

In 2021, there were 481 total private dwellings, of which 307 were occupied by usual residents. The average household size was 2.4 persons per household, and nearly all occupied dwellings were single-detached houses (305 out of 310).

Household SizeNumber of Households
1 person60
2 persons135
3 persons50
4 persons45
5+ persons15

Demographics (Race / Ethnicity)

The community is predominantly non-visible minority (720 people), with only 25 people identified as visible minorities. A significant share of residents (160 people, about 21%) identified with Indigenous identity, primarily First Nations.

GroupPopulationPercent
Indigenous identity16021.5%
Visible minority253.4%
Not a visible minority72096.6%

Income & Poverty

In 2020, the median household income was $100,000, and the median after-tax household income was $81,000, higher than many rural areas of the province. Despite this, 8.8% of the population lived below the Low-Income Measure (LIM-AT), with higher rates among seniors (14%).

  • Median household income (2020): $100,000
  • Median after-tax household income: $81,000
  • Low-income prevalence (LIM-AT): 8.8%

Employment

In 2021, the labour force participation rate was 65.4%, with an employment rate of 53.5% and an unemployment rate of 18.1%, significantly higher than the national average.

Occupations were spread across various fields, with health care, sales and service, and trades/transport making up the bulk of employment.

Industry Highlights:

  • Health care & social assistance: 80 workers
  • Construction: 55 workers
  • Retail trade: 35 workers
  • Transportation & warehousing: 35 workers

Commuting & Transportation

Like most rural regions, transportation is heavily car-dependent. Of the employed labour force:

  • 93% commute by car, truck, or van (mostly as drivers).
  • Only 10 people reported walking to work.
  • Public transit use was 0.

Commute times are relatively short, with 62% commuting less than 30 minutes.
